Responsibilities Conduct comprehensive behavioral assessments, including functional behavior assessments Develop and oversee individualized ABA treatment plans Supervise and support RBTs and Behavior Technicians Analyze client data and adjust interventions based on progress Provide parent training and caregiver collaboration Maintain accurate documentation in compliance with HIPAA and payer requirements Deliver both clinic-based and in-home ABA services Collaborate with interdisciplinary teams as needed Skills & Qualifications Master's degree in Behavior Analysis, Psychology, Education, or related field Active BCBA certification (required) Active Virginia LBA (or eligibility to obtain) Ability to travel within assigned region Reliable transportation for hybrid service delivery
